ROSSO RISERVA DEGLI ORZONI Collio DOC Russiz Superiore
The Orzoni family was one of the noble families who owned the Russiz Superiore estate between 1558 and 1770. Even back then, they identified a special plot of land for the production of red wines, marked on the old cadastral maps created in the 18th century, during the time of Maria Teresa, and later completed by the Napoleonic administration.

Type of soil
The Collio’s hilly terrain, formed during the Eocene period, consists of layers of sandstone and loam rock (limestone and clay) that were once part of the ocean floor. The resulting soil is impermeable, so rainwater flows off its surface, producing little erosion and preventing stagnant water.

Vinificazione
After destemming, the must and pulp undergo maceration in temperature-controlled stainless steel tanks for a variable period depending on the year. The wine refines for two years in oak barrels and then one more year in the bottle.
Characteristics
Deep ruby-red color with purple hues. Intense, elegant and complex aroma with hints of currant, blackberry, with delicate spicy and balsamic hints. Full-bodied in the mouth, it has a pleasant long finish.
